display system internal l2vpn ldp
Use display system internal l2vpn ldp to display information about the LDP PW labels of a backup LDP
process.
Syntax
MSR4000:
display system internal l2vpn ldp [ peer ip-address [ pw-id pw-id ] ] [ verbose ] standby slot slot-number
Views
Any view
Predefined user roles
network-admin
Parameters
peer ip-address: Displays LDP PW label information advertised to and received from the specified peer
PE. The ip-address argument specifies the LSR ID of the peer PE. If no peer PE is specified, the command
displays LDP PW label information advertised by all peer PEs.
pw-id pw-id: Displays LDP PW label information for the PW specified by its PW ID in the range of 1 to
4294967295. If peer ip-address is specified without this option, the command displays all LDP PW label
information advertised to and received from the specified peer PE.
verbose: Displays detailed information. Without this keyword, the command displays brief information.
standby: Displays backup LDP process information.
slot slot-number: Specifies a card. The slot-number argument represents the number of the slot that holds
the card. (MSR4000.)
Usage guidelines
This command displays the following:
• All the LDP PW labels received by the local device.
• The PW labels successfully advertised from the local device to the peer PEs.
